The Treatment for Refractive Lens Exchange



When undergoing refractive lens exchange, the cosmetic surgeon will certainly begin by making a tiny incision in your cornea. This permits them to access the lens of your eye and remove it.

Right here are five vital actions involved in the procedure:

- The cosmetic surgeon will carefully separate the lens using ultrasound waves or lasers.
- After eliminating the lens, they'll insert a new man-made lens, called an intraocular lens (IOL), right into your eye.
- The IOL is developed to fix your specific vision problems, such as nearsightedness, farsightedness, or astigmatism.
- Once the brand-new lens remains in location, the doctor will close the cut with tiny stitches or self-sealing methods.
- The entire procedure generally takes less than thirty minutes and is typically done on an outpatient basis.

Complying with these actions, refractive lens exchange can supply you with enhanced vision and decrease your dependence on glasses or get in touch with lenses.

Prospective Risks of Refractive Lens Exchange



Before undertaking refractive lens exchange, it is essential to comprehend the potential threats associated with the treatment. While refractive lens exchange is generally taken into consideration secure, like any operation, there are dangers included.

One possible threat is infection, which can occur if microorganisms gets in the eye during or after the surgical procedure. Another threat is the development of boosted intraocular pressure, which can bring about glaucoma. In addition, there's a small chance of experiencing corneal edema, which is the swelling of the cornea.

Various other possible threats consist of retinal detachment, macular edema, and loss of vision. It's important to discuss these threats with your specialist and consider them versus the potential benefits before deciding.
